Washington, Jan. 9 -- Congressman Ron Estes issued the following press release:

This week, Congressman Ron Estes (R-Kansas) joined Bipartisan Fiscal Forum (BFF) Co-Chairs Bill Huizenga (R-Michigan) and Scott Peters (D-California), in addition to Reps. Lloyd Smucker (R-Pennsylvania), and Mike Quigley (D-Illinois), to introduce House Resolution 981 (https://www.congress.gov/bill/119th-congress/house-resolution/981) establishing a clear fiscal goal - reduce the federal budget deficit to 3% of gross domestic product (GDP) or lower.
